Freedom Foundation of Nova Scotia is a charitable organization based in Dartmouth, Nova Scotia, classified by the CRA under core health care. It appears on the charity register the way hospitals, universities, and other publicly funded bodies do — to issue tax receipts — rather than as a donation-driven charity in the usual sense. In its fiscal year ending March 31, 2024, it reported $613K in revenue and $531K in expenditures.

Its funding that year was roughly 77% from government, 5% from other charities. Government funding is the majority of its budget. In 2024, 6 other registered charities reported granting it a combined $23K.

Compared with 739 health institutions of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 76% of peers. Its highest-paid positions fell in the $40,000–79,999 range (4 positions in that band). The charity reported 10 permanent full-time positions.

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 13 names.

In its own words

The foundation operates two transition houses that provide services which foster recovery from addictions and development of positive self image and self worth. The foundation helps with treatment phase of recovery and helps transition residents back into the workforce. The transition navigator program helps plan recreational activities (fishing walking etc).

Ongoing-program description from its T3010 filing, verbatim.
